My partner has just had her UK visit visa declined under the grounds that she did not provide any assets or family that gives enough reason for her to return home.

I must admit I was fairly confident this visa would be approved as this is the third time we have applied, always providing the exact same documents and supporting evidence. Yet for some reason this time she has been refused.

Is there a way to appeal this or should I apply again? How can she prove her family ties? Bearing in mind on her application she states she has 3 dependent children not travelling with her, so she will clearly have to return home to look after them.

Can UK visitor visa be rejected?

UK visitor visas are commonly refused due to issues with the application. If you need a visa to visit the UK, you will have to show that you satisfy the visitor visa requirements or you will be refused permission.

What happens after refusal visa visit UK?

You can make a fresh application addressing the grounds of refusal with the submission of new evidence and fee. There is no time limit for making a fresh application. So, you can reapply any time after your UK visa refusal.

Is Visit Visa Open in UK now?

You can apply for a visit visa from any UK VAC . You should apply for all other UK visas from the country you're living in. If your VAC is closed due to coronavirus restrictions, you can apply online and select a VAC in another country worldwide to submit your application and biometrics.
